Quadriplegia is a condition
resulting from damage to the spine leading to a loss of
movement in the arms and the legs. The guidelines say
that the level of award consequent upon claims for such
injury would be between £165,000 to £205,000. In making
an assessment of particular claims, the extent of any
residual movement and the amount of pain being suffered
would be taken into account. Also to be considered in
assessing the level of claims award would be
whether the accident victim was suffering
depression. His age and life expectancy would also be
relevant. Compensation would be awarded at
the upper end of the range where there was a
significant effect on senses or communication
abilities.
